MK2KungBroken Wrote: Having to hold LP for 25 seconds against a good MK2 player wouldn't be the easiest thing to do, and it's a sweep distance Fatality, I remember many times it just not working at all. |
True...hardest to pull off because you can't do any special moves/morphs. Against a good MK2 player it's almost impossible. But remember, if you start holding LP before the round starts you don't have to hold for 25 seconds. Then, get right next to them, tap back and release...there's your sweep distance.

Konqrr, that's a good point about holding it at the beginning of the round, I hadn't thought about that. Holding any charge move at the beginning of the round will allow it to happen instantly, so if you begin a round as Liu Kang or Jax, press LK the instant before fight and let go and the charge move simply happens.
